Corrections to the energy levels of ground state excitons embedded in a gas of excitons, electrons, and holes are obtained within the framework of the Green's function technique. Contributions of the interaction with free carriers and excitons are considered in the first Born approximation, and plasmon effects are taken into account. Numerical values are given for the exciton energy shift linear in the densities at different temperatures and different electron—hole mass ratios.
